Studies of Oxygen Effect on Model Catalyst Rh/TiO2 in SMSI State Full article

Abstract: Treatment of the model system Rh/TiO2 in the SMSI state by oxygen is shown to restore properties of the initial surface. A scheme to account for the observed transformations is suggested.
